Mitbewohnerin
Mitbewohnerin is the German word for a female flatmate or housemate. It refers to a woman who shares a dwelling, such as an apartment or house, with one or more other individuals. The term is derived from the German words "Mit-" meaning "with" or "co-", and "Bewohnerin" meaning "female inhabitant" or "resident".
